Roberts et al. 2011
Vancomycin Dosing in Critically Ill Patients: Robust Methods for Improved Continuous-Infusion Regimens
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y · 10.1128/AAC.01708-10
Structure
A one-compartment model, driven by weight and creatinine clearance.
Study population
Critically ill patients — Belgium and Europe. Fitted to 206 patients and 579 concentration observations.
| Covariate | As reported |
|---|---|
| Age | 58.1 ± 14.8 yr |
| Weight | 74.8 ± 15.8 kg |
| BMI | 25.9 ± 5.4 kg/m² |
| CrCl | 90.7 ± 60.4 mL/min |
Reported as the source publication gives them — mean ± SD, or median with range or interquartile range.
Equations
The model's structural parameters as Chorus implements them.
LaTeX source
CL = CrCl \cdot \frac{4.58 \cdot 1.73}{100 \cdot BSA}
V_1 = 1.53 \cdot Weight
Implementation notes
Continuous infusion model for critically ill septic patients.
